Runbook: Lanternbuild hermetic migration

Support notes for the Coppermill CI fleet. As of this week, all release builds run under Lanternbuild's hermetic sandbox — no network, no host toolchains. If a customer reports a failed build citing missing system libraries, that's expected; point them to the vendored toolchain docs. Do not re-enable legacy mode; it breaks cache keys fleet-wide. If a sandbox worker needs to be recreated, provision it with the following configuration values:

config for bahop-fajep:
DRUATH_PIN=4501
DRUATH_TENANT=briwyn
DRUATH_METRICS_HOST=metrics.druath.brasksoft.test
DRUATH_SEAL=seal_7d2e069d
DRUATH_STANDBY_TEAM=olieth

## Ownership

This repo contains Dedupler, the on-call alert deduplicator for the Marbeck platform. It collapses duplicate pages within a five-minute window before they hit the paging queue. Releases ship weekly; cut from main only. Do not tag a release without confirming the dedupe ruleset is frozen. All release approvals go through the maintainer named below.

account owner for bawip-tahag: Raleth Quenok

## Onboarding: Farebranch Rules Engine

Plugin authors integrate with Farebranch by registering fee rules against the evaluation API. Rules are sandboxed; they cannot perform network calls directly. All rate-table lookups go through the host, which validates your plugin manifest at load time. Your local env file must include the signing credential the host uses to verify manifests, set on the next line.

secret setting of bajef-fajof: COURIER_KEY3=76c

# Onboarding — Flagstone Rollout Framework

Flagstone controls staged feature rollouts across all Norvane services. Review scope: the evaluation engine, the targeting rule parser, and the kill-switch path. Rollout configs are immutable once published; changes require a new version. All config bundles are signed at publish time and verified by every edge agent before evaluation — unsigned or tampered bundles are dropped and alarmed. Audit logs live in the compliance bucket, retained two years. Bundle verification uses the key below.

rollout seal: bky4_DFM9